What is Fentanyl?

Fentanyl is a Class A managed drug under the Misuse of Drugs Act 1971. It was originally developed for palliative care and serious persistent discomfort management, particularly for clients who have actually developed a tolerance to other opioids. In a medical setting, fentanyl is administered in microgram dosages, as even a tiny discrepancy in dose can lead to fatal breathing anxiety.

In the UK, fentanyl is primarily used for:

  • Management of breakthrough cancer pain.
  • Severe chronic pain where other analgesics are insufficient.
  • Anesthesia throughout major surgeries.

In the United Kingdom, it is impossible to "buy" fentanyl nonprescription or through any standard retail outlet. It is a prescription-only medication (POM). Additionally,  click here  to the fact that it is categorized as a Schedule 2 Controlled Drug under the Misuse of Drugs Regulations 2001, its storage, prescription, and dispensing go through strenuous oversight by the Home Office and the NHS.

The Prescription Process

To legally get fentanyl, a patient should go through a thorough medical assessment. The procedure generally follows these steps:

  1. Clinical Assessment: A General Practitioner (GP) or a specialist discomfort expert evaluates the patient's case history and the severity of their pain.
  2. Trial of Alternative Therapies: Usually, fentanyl is just thought about after less potent opioids (like codeine or tramadol) have actually proven ineffective.
  3. Managed Prescription: The prescription should fulfill particular legal requirements, consisting of the overall amount written in both words and figures.
  4. Drug store Verification: The pharmacist must confirm the prescriber's qualifications and, in most cases, the identity of the individual collecting the medication.

Kinds of Medical Fentanyl Available in the UK

Fentanyl is offered in a number of delivery systems developed to offer either slow-release pain relief or rapid relief for "advancement" discomfort occasions.

Table 1: Common Pharmaceutical Forms of Fentanyl in the UK

FormBrand Name Names (Common in UK)Primary UseDuration of Action
Transdermal PatchDurogesic, Matrifen, MezolarPersistent, stable pain72 hours per patch
Lozenge (Lollipop)ActiqBreakthrough cancer painFast start (15-- 30 mins)
Sublingual TabletsAbstralDevelopment painLiquifies under the tongue
Nasal SprayPecFent, InstanylAcute advancement painReally quick beginning
Injectable SolutionSublimazeSurgical anesthesiaImmediate (IV/IM)

Safety and Storage Requirements

For patients who have actually been lawfully recommended fentanyl spots or tablets in the UK, strict safety protocols need to be followed:

  • Secure Storage: Fentanyl should be kept in a locked cabinet, out of reach of children and family pets. Even an utilized spot contains enough residual fentanyl to be fatal to a child.
  • Disposal: Used patches need to be folded in half (sticky side together) and went back to a drug store for safe disposal.
  • The "Yellow Card" Scheme: Patients are motivated to report any unexpected side impacts to the Medicines and Healthcare products Regulatory Agency (MHRA) through the Yellow Card app.

4. Can I take a trip into the UK with fentanyl prescribed in another nation?

Yes, however you need to follow Home Office guidelines. You normally require a letter from your prescribing physician and might need an individual license if you are carrying more than a three-month supply. Constantly check current Home Office "Travelling with controlled drugs" guidelines before getting here.

5. What are the indications of a fentanyl overdose?

Signs consist of identify students, blue or grey tint to the lips/fingernails, cold or clammy skin, gurgling sounds, and considerably sluggish or absent breathing.
